Unlocking Cuyahoga County Property Records
Cuyahoga County property records hold a wealth of information about real estate throughout the county. Whether are curious about your own property or must have permission Public record in cuyahoga county to records for legal purposes, understanding how to unlock these records is crucial.
Let's a guide to navigating the Cuyahoga County property record system. The county makes available several choices for researching property data. One popular method is using their online platform, which allows you to search records by parcel number. As an alternative is to attend the Cuyahoga County Recorder's Office in person. They have a physical archive of property records that are open to the public.

Obtain Cuyahoga County Court Documents Online
Need to lookup court documents related to a case in Cuyahoga County? You're in luck! The clerk's office offers an online platform that allows you to browse records electronically. This convenient tool can save you time and effort compared to visiting the courthouse in person. To get started, you'll need to navigate to the official website for Cuyahoga County Court Records. Once there, you can provide case information such as defendant/plaintiff and filing dates. The system will then display a list of relevant documents that are available for examination.
Keep in mind that some documents may be restricted due to privacy concerns or other legal reasons.
